Where should you put a quote in an essay?

When you use a short quote, include it directly in your paragraph, along with your own words. To help the reader understand the quote and why you’re using it, write a full sentence that includes the quote, rather than just lifting a sentence from another work and putting it into your paper.

How do you put a quote in the beginning of an essay?

To quote a critic or researcher, you can use an introductory phrase naming the source, followed by a comma. Note that the first letter after the quotation marks should be upper case. According to MLA guidelines, if you change the case of a letter from the original, you must indicate this with brackets.

How do you quote text in a research paper?

In-text citations include the last name of the author followed by a page number enclosed in parentheses. “Here’s a direct quote” (Smith 8). If the author’s name is not given, then use the first word or words of the title. Follow the same formatting that was used in the works cited list, such as quotation marks.

Do you need quotes in a research paper?

In all research papers with formatting guidelines (APA, AMA, MLA, etc.), quoted text must be accompanied by quotation marks and in-text citation. When you paraphrase, you do not need to include quotations marks, but you must still cite the original work.

What does MLA stand for in writing?

Modern Language Association
MLA (Modern Language Association) style is most commonly used to write papers and cite sources within the liberal arts and humanities.

Why do we use MLA?

Why Use MLA? Using MLA Style properly makes it easier for readers to navigate and comprehend a text through familiar cues that refer to sources and borrowed information. Editors and instructors also encourage everyone to use the same format so there is consistency of style within a given field.
